CNA Financial Corp. 8-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report was filed by CNA Financial Corporation on November 7, 2008, with the latest event reported on November 12, 2008. The filing addresses significant capital raising activities and executive leadership changes.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ing discloses a specific capital transaction but does not provide comprehensive financial statements, revenue, profit, or cash flow data for the period.
- Capital Raised: $1.25 billion.
- Instrument: 12,500 shares of non-voting cumulative 2008 Senior Preferred Stock.
- Investor: Loews Corporation.
Material Changes
The primary material change is the consummation of the preferred stock issuance to Loews Corporation. Additionally, the company announced a change in executive leadership structure effective December 31, 2008.
Management Commentary and Personnel Changes
James R. Lewis, President and Chief Executive Officer of Property and Casualty Operations, is departing upon the expiration of his term on December 31, 2008. Following his departure, executives currently reporting to Mr. Lewis will report directly to Thomas F. Motamed, the incoming Chairman and Chief Executive Officer.
